Biosketch

Anuj Gupta, MD, is an Associate Professor at the University of Maryland School of Medicine. An interventional cardiologist, he serves as clinical co-director (in conjunction with Charles Hong, MD, PHD) of the Division of Cardiovascular Medicine at the University of Maryland School of Medicine. His primary focus is on the treatment of severe aortic stenosis in patients who are eligible for transcatheter aortic valve replacement (TAVR). In his role evaluating TAVR and related therapies, he is the site principal investigator for the PARTNER 2 trial, Early TAVR Trial, Galileo Trial, and the Medtronic low-risk, randomized trial for TAVR. In addition, he is involved in renal denervation studies, including the SYMPLICITY-HTN3 trial and Reduce HTN: Reinforce trial.

He is a past Governor of the Maryland Chapter of the American College of Cardiology, the professional society for cardiologists and related cardioavascular specialists. He is a principal in the Maryland Academic Consortium for Percutaneous Coronary Intervention Appropriateness and Quality (MACPAQ), a joint initiative between Johns Hopkins University School of Medicine and the University of Maryland School of Medicine to create a system of external peer review for PCI in the state of Maryland. External peer review, a state requirement for providing PCI services, demonstrates that hospitals in Maryland are providing appropriate, high-quality PCI services.

Research Interests

Multicenter clinical trials evaluating the efficacy of transcatheter aortic valve replacement systems for the treatment of severe, symptomatic aortic stenosis in patients at various risk for surgical aortic valve replacement forms the bulwark of my research efforts.

In addition, efforts to reduce renal toxicity by contrast preservation methods in patients being evaluated for TAVR has formed a secondary interest.  These patients, often elderly with renal dysfunction, benefit from efforts to reduce contrast exposure.

As external peer review establishes itself in the state of Maryland, future efforts will evaluate Appropriate Use Criteria in the context of interventional cardiology reviewed PCI procedures.

Clinical Specialty Details

My main clinical specialties include treatment of coronary disease for acute coronary syndrome, cardiogenic shock, and cardiac arrest, as well as patients declined by cardiac surgery due to patient's high surgical risk.  In addition, I have established, since its inception and along with my surgical colleagues, the Transcatheter Aortic Valve Replacement program at the University of Maryland.
